Working Hard or Hardly Working? How the Swedish Building Trade Magazines Mediate Issues Regarding Energy Efficiency

Karlsson, Emilia January 2015 (has links)
The building sector accounts for 40 % of the energy usage, and to be able to reach the energy reduction goals set within the EU and Sweden, the building sector needs to change toward energy efficiency. The building sector has a lot of energy saving potential, and within the sector, the HVAC- and plumbing section has the greatest saving potential. Since building trade magazines are directed to practitioners within the building sector, and also their main channel for information regarding projects and developments, this study has used qualitative content analysis on articles, regarding energy efficiency, between the years of 2002-2014. Two building magazines and one HVAC- and plumbing magazine were used to cover the field of what issues regarding energy efficiency were mediated to the readers. The study found out that during the first years, the magazines mediated a positive image towards energy efficiency measures, but mentioned little concrete action plans. After the implementation of more stringent laws, the magazines mediated different issues in a more equal spreading, however two different issues battled to be heard. These were concerns regarding the risks of using new methods not tried before, the lack of clear definitions from the authorities and a focus on a holistic perspective that included environmental thinking. The most recent years focused on practical solutions, adopting a holistic perspective that included both buildings and individual behaviors. During the years, the magazines in general framed energy efficiency measures as something positive and mediated the image of that energy efficiency measures would be taken in the future.

Establishment and Application Analysis of Building Energy Performance Certificate Evaluation Systems in Taiwan

Tang, Shih-chieh 10 July 2010 (has links)
Being located in subtropical climates, the cooling energy accounts for a huge percentage of the total power consumption, and has become the major cause for power shortages. Therefore, building energy conservation strategies has become the major remedy to tackle this problem. In this study, the building energy performance certificate evaluation system has been established, in referencing the European communities systems, while integrating the financial and consumers factors to establish the building labeling system in Taiwan.

Energideklarationens roll och ändamålsenlighet på den svenska fastighetsmarknaden : En analys av EPC-systemets relevans som modell för energieffektivisering / The Role of the Energy Performance Certificate, and the Fulfillment of its Purpose on the Swedish Real Estate Market : An Analysis of the Relevance of the EPC System as a Model for Energy Efficiency

Sandin, Hedvig, Sandell, Joanna January 2022 (has links)
Energieffektivisering av byggnadsbeståndet är en viktig del av EU:s klimatarbete, och systemet med energideklarationen (EPC) är ett centralt politiskt verktyg för ändamålet. Forskningen om hur EPC påverkat fastighetsmarknaden är dock inte helt entydig. Fastän statistisk forskning huvudsakligen tyder på ett samband mellan en högre energiklass och en högre köpeskilling, marknadsförs inte energiklassen som en lönsam grön strategi. Genom att intervjua svenska fastighetsaktörer om deras syn på och användning av energideklarationen ämnar denna studie undersöka om EPC-märkningen (energiklassen), som ingår som ett obligatorium i alla försäljnings- och hyresannonser, spelar någon roll för betalningsvilja och investeringsbeslut. I det fall det finns en lönsamhet i energieffektivitet borde energideklarationen vara ett värdefullt informationsverktyg. Den borde dessutom leda till en kontinuerlig förbättring av energiklasserna i det svenska byggnadsbeståndet och på lång sikt bidra till att uppnå klimatmål på nationell och internationell nivå. År 2022 väntas tillägg till befintlig EU-lagstiftning som kommer öka fokus på energieffektivisering för att uppnå de globala klimatmålen, vilket gör det än mer angeläget att utreda EPC-systemets tillämpning och potentiella fördelar på den svenska fastighetsmarknaden. Resultaten av denna studie visar att EPC-märkningen inte har haft en speciellt stor inverkan på marknaden sedan den infördes eftersom den inte skapar ekonomiska incitament att investera i energieffektivitet, och de energieffektiviseringsåtgärder som deklarationen föreslår är alltför generiska och bristfälliga. På det hela taget har deklarationen en svag ställning och är för närvarande främst begränsad till en formalitet. Värdet av en bra energiklass kommer dock sannolikt att öka till följd av implementeringen av EU-taxonomin, och denna ökning beror till stor del på de finansiella fördelar en bra energiklass kan medföra. Resultaten i denna uppsats ifrågasätter ett energiklassningssystem i Sverige som inte fungerar som det ska eftersom det inte bidrar till att öka energieffektiviteten i det svenska byggnadsbeståndet, och understryker vikten av kompletterande politik som kan uppmuntra investeringar i rätt riktning. / Improving the energy efficiency of the building stock is an important part of the EU's climate work, and the Energy Performance Certificate (EPC) scheme is a key policy tool for this purpose. Research on the impact of the Energy Performance Certificates (EPC) on the real estate market is not entirely clear. While statistical research mainly suggests a correlation between a better energy class and a higher price, the energy class is not being marketed as a profitable green strategy. By interviewing Swedish real estate actors about their views on the energy performance certificate (EPC) this study seeks to investigate whether the EPC label, which is included as a mandatory element in all sales and rental advertisements, plays a role in willingness to pay and investment decisions. If there is a profitability in energy efficiency, the EPC should be a valuable information tool. In addition, it should lead to a continuous improvement of the energy performance of the Swedish building stock, and in the long term contribute to achieving climate goals at national and international level. In 2022, amendments to existing EU legislation are expected that will increase the focus on energy efficiency to achieve the global climate goals, making it even more urgent to investigate the application and potential benefits of the EPC scheme in the Swedish real estate market. The result of this study shows that the EPC label has not had a significant impact on the market since its introduction, since it does not create financial incentives to invest in energy efficiency and since the energy efficiency improvement measures proposed by the declaration are too generic and insufficient. On the whole, the energy performance certificate has a weak position and is currently mainly limited to a formality. However, the value of a good energy class is likely to increase as a result of the implementation of the EU taxonomy, and this transition is largely dependent on the financial benefits a good energy rating can bring. The findings of this paper call into question an energy labeling scheme in Sweden that is not working as it should, that is, to increase energy efficiency in the Swedish building stock, and underline the importance of complementary policies that can encourage investment in the right direction.

Mažo daugiabučio namo atnaujinimas iki beveik nulinės energijos pastato / Low energy refurbishment of existing small multi-residential buildings

Janulis, Rokas 23 July 2012 (has links)
Daugiabučių modernizavimo problema nagrinėjama, remiantis Europos Komisijos išleista "Energijos vartojimo efektyvumo pastatuose" direktyva. Darbe atkreipiamas dėmesys į mažų daugiabučių, kurie gyvenamųjų pastatų modernizavimo procese sudaro mažumą, sektorių. Darbe siekiama įvertinti tipinio mažo daugiabučio renovacijos galimybę iki beveik nulinės energijos pastato koncepcijos rodiklių, kuri buvo pateikta kaip reikalavimas visiems ES naujai statomiems pastatams nuo 2020 m. (viešosios paskirties - nuo 2018 m.) Tyrimo metu buvo atlikti eksperimentiniai elementų šiluminių savybių matavimai, kurie vėliau panaudoti pastato energijos balanso skaičiavimams bei energinio modelio sudarymui. Pritaikant dažniausiai naudojamas energijos taupymo priemones, modeliuojami keli mažai energijos vartojančio pastato variantai. Naudojantis programine įranga, sumodeliuotas galimas energijos tiekimas pastatui iš atsinaujinančių energijos šaltinių, siekiant užtikrinti kuo didesnę AEŠ dalį pastato energijos balanse. Atlikti ekonominiai modernizavimo variantų vertinimai. Pagal pasirinktą kriterijų pateiktas labiausiai šalies mastu tinkantis, atsižvelgiant į Lietuvos daugiabučių namų rinką, ekonominius bei energetinius rodiklius, daugiabučio energinis modelis. / The issue of multi-residential building refurbishing is being analyzed reffering to the "Energy performance of building directive", introduces by European Commission. This paper puts attention to the share of buildings that takes the minority by participating in residential building renovation program. Research is made to assess the case study of refurbishing a small scale residential building achieving a performance of nearly zero energy building. In the directive it is stated, that from year 2020 all newly built buildings will have to be nearly zero energy. All new public buildings must have this energy performance from the year 2018. During the research, experimental measurements of thermal characteristics of thermal envelope elements were made. These results were used to stimulate the yearly energy balance and create energy model of the building. With the use of most common renewable energy techniques and energy saving measures, several energy models were analyzed. With the use of sophisticated computer software, possible energy supply schemes with high share of RES were introduced. Energy supply solutions were analyzed on an economic basis. Referring on set criterions, most suitable solution of energy supply scenario is offered, considering the real estate market, economic and energetic indexes of Lithuania.

Architektonický výraz obytných staveb energeticky efektivní výstavby / Architectural expression of residential buildings in energy-efficient housing

Gerö, Jiří January 2013 (has links)
These days create an enormous pressure on energy savings because of their high prices. For future it is obvious that their prices will grow. Not only the representatives of European Union realize this fact, but basicaly common people who run their houses and pay the bills. For this reason low - energy houses respectively passive houses are in the limelight. Reasons of economy should not be the only criterion of quality, but its integral part, one of several components. Energy efficient housing is a response in architecture and building to turbulent global warming. The aim of the work is try to specify how to conceive an efficient building with respect to its architectural quality in the contect of directions coming from European Union and which should be implemented soon in the Czech republic. Will zero house become driving force of architecture in Europe in 21st century? The result of the work will be useful in orientation how to conceive an efficient house with respect to its aesthetical quality.

The Development Of A Building Energy Performance Evaluation Program (enad) For Architectural Design Process

Cakici, Fatma Zehra 01 January 2013 (has links) (PDF)
Energy performance in buildings has become one of the most broadly debated subjects in contemporary architecture / and current legislation has emphasized its importance by requiring buildings to possess an energy performance certificate. Due to the technological advances in computational tools, it is possible to analyze the energy performance of buildings before construction starts / however most energy performance evaluation tools, requiring complex solid models and high technical knowledge in the field, can be used only during the post design phases. Since any design decision has an important effect on the energy performance of a building, evaluation tools should be used from the very beginning of the design process. In this dissertation, a building energy performance evaluation program, entitled the Energy performance Advisor (EnAd), was developed for evaluating the energy performance of buildings considering not only the legal framework of Turkey, but also the building design process. The program does not need advanced expertise, and was developed to be usable in any phase of the design process. The program, using the monthly calculation method of TS EN ISO 13790, was developed based on the European Union Directive on Energy Performance in Buildings (EPBD) and the current Turkish legislation on the subject. EnAd integrates the legal framework with the energy performance criterion into the building design process, while providing rapid feedback on energy performance and related legislation, and guiding the designer to improve design decisions. This dissertation has also shown the effects of building size, exposed surfaces, ventilation and infiltration, window-wall ratio, U-values, set-point temperatures and temperature differences between the outside and inside spaces on energy performance of buildings through generic case studies while searching the reasons for discrepancies between the results derived from the four evaluation tools, three of which is highly acknowledged energy performance evaluation tools. The validity, reliability, precision and usability of EnAd as a design-support tool has been proved through the usability and convergence tests conducted. Finally, the thesis has pointed out the importance of the use of energy performance evaluation tools from early stages of architectural design process to achieve higher performances as well as the roles of decision makers in this process.
